## Deployment

Quick refresher before Thursday's sync: GateTally (the turnstile counter for Harrowfield Stadium) ships as a single container behind the venue proxy. Deploys go out via the usual pipeline — tag, wait for the smoke check against the south-gate simulator, then promote. Don't deploy on match days; ask Priya from ops if you're unsure what counts. Rollbacks are one command and take about a minute. For reference, the service currently runs with the following configuration values.

service settings:
PRAIX_LOG_LEVEL=error
PRAIX_METRICS_HOST=metrics.praix.qorvelcorp.corp
PRAIX_POOL_SIZE=16

**Ticket: Pooler creds expired**

The Quillbase connection pooler on Velstra staging rejected all checkouts at 03:10. Cause: the service credential rotated out last week and nobody updated the pooler config. Pool exhausts within minutes as retries pile up. Restart after patching config. Use the replacement key below.

API key for tagug-tajef: vxb4-R1fo

## v2.8.0 — Thresher Gateway

- Renamed `TG_UPLINK_KEY` to `TG_UPLINK_SECRET` to match the naming convention for sensitive values; the old name is still read with a deprecation warning until v3.0.
- Telemetry batching interval now configurable via `TG_BATCH_MS` (default 500).
- Dropped support for the legacy CAN-bus shim.

Reviewers: confirm downstream configs reference the new name. Local env files should define the renamed secret on the line immediately after this entry.

vault entry, yahif-yajep: COURIER_KEY29=b802bdf8034096b65a51c6ba5abe2